Woman gangraped by five men in Delhi, 4 arrested

A 25-year-old woman was gang-raped by five men in Defence Colony area on Saturday night, police said on Sunday.

A woman has alleged that she was gangraped by five men at a flat in South Delhi on Saturday-Sunday night. Police have arrested four of the accused, while one is absconding.

According to police, the 25-year-old woman filed a complaint at the Defence Colony police station that five men — Aakash (23), Deepak (20), Aman (20) and two others — raped her in Aman’s flat in South Delhi’s Dakshinpuri area. They then dropped her on a road in Khanpur area where police found her after an autorickshaw driver alerted police.

A senior police officer said, “Aakash, Aman and Deepak allegedly kidnapped her and took her to Aman’s flat in Dakshinpuri, where they were joined by two other friends. They allegedly took turns to rape her. The woman was then dumped.” The autorickshaw driver filed a complaint around 2.45 am, giving the number of the car Aman was driving.
